I have a level made up mostly of models. The sun casts light on it from whatever combination of elevation and azimuth happens to be set in the map properties, causing the nearest side of the models to be brighter than other sides.

Unfortunately this isn't working for me and I need to get rid of the sunlight altogether. I tried setting it's rgb to all zeroes, but the sun STILL casts!!!! I tried changing the ambient as well, but no matter what I do the sun still casts from whatever direction its in.

I want to light my level with static lights ONLY and get rid of the sun because it is messing up my models (especially at 90 elevation, it completely washes out the texture of my sidewalks).

Anyone have any advice?

Manual:
Code:
MATERIAL* mtl_nosun ={  ambient_blue = 100;  ambient_green = 100;  ambient_red = 100;  albedo = -100;}


Albedo = -100 => no sun light reflection.

Thank you very much! That worked quite well.

Strangely though my model showed up darker than it should have (the white textures were gray). I set the rgb ambients to 130 and that seemed to bring the texture brightness up to normal. Do you think there's anything in the map properties or build settings that could affect the model textures this way even though albedo is turned off in my script?

I think the rgb settings at 128 each are default so you are able to make your objects darker.
